Item Fortalecimiento en la gestión comercial de las empresas afiliadas a la Cámara de Comercio e Industria Colombo ChilenaNiño-Delgadillo, Leidy Yohana; Buitrago-Lara, Heilin Ginneth; Bonilla-Garcés, Sergio David; Rocha Alfonso, AndresThe objective of this work is to carry out a quantitative and qualitative study about the Colombian Chilean Chamber of Commerce and Industry (CCICC), which as an entity that manages the promotion and conducts the establishment of lasting links, has played a crucial role in improving relations between Colombian and Chilean companies having as a priority their affiliated companies, whose interest is the creation of contact, later, the offer of goods and services that have affiliated companies from different sectors, to achieve this an exhaustive search of the information is necessary by the CCICC in order to reach the target companies that each affiliate seeks, as well as the development and implementation of new businesses between the two countries through interpersonal relationships. Through a survey study, the concept of the commercials and managers who work within it is made known through surveys, this in order to have concrete results of the different opinions on the commercial management carried out. The surveys are designed with open, multiple-choice and assessment questions to have a better perception of the opinion of the different interest groups, once the information is collected, it is analyzed and the statement of the problem to which it will be sought. provide a solution based on the objectives set and the strategies created for improvement purposes within the CCICC, this improvement will be made through the creation of a value proposition that allows improving the flow of information within the CCICC and increasing interpersonal relationships between the affiliates and the CCICC, also between the affiliates themselves and the companies outside the CCICC in order to generate greater loyalty on the part of the affiliates by meeting business needs by creating contact.
